Я использую .NET Core 2.1 для веб-приложения.Я пытаюсь использовать SSL с самозаверяющим сертификатом (который работает нормально в Windows).Но попытка получить доступ к этим веб-сайтам на моем тестовом устройстве или эмуляторе не работает, потому что сертификат ядра .net не работает, потому что сертификат не на этих устройствах.Это имеет смысл.
Я должен использовать SSL, потому что я пытаюсь использовать OpenIddict и Identity Model для аутентификации приложения, и (по крайней мере) клиент UWP не будет работать при подключении не-ssl (которое,для разработки, я думаю, что это глупо, но не в этом суть)
Как я могу сгенерировать сертификат для использования Kestrel / .NET Core, а затем доверять этому сертификату на устройстве Android или iOS?Это не так просто, как просто установить сертификат на предполагаемое устройство, сайт все еще не пользуется доверием.